Let’s go step by step to figure out the correct measuring equipment and method for each ingredient.
We have three types of measuring tools:
- Measuring spoons (A, B, C, D) — for small amounts like teaspoons and tablespoons.
- A = 1/4 tsp
- B = 1/2 tsp
- C = 1 tsp
- D = 1 Tbsp (which is 3 tsp)
- Dry/solid measuring cups (E, F, G, H) — for dry ingredients like flour, sugar, oats. You fill them and level off.
- E = 1 cup
- F = 1/2 cup
- G = 1/3 cup
- H = 1/4 cup
- Liquid measuring cup (I) — for liquids like milk or oil. You pour and look at eye level.
And two methods:
- J: Dip in, level off → used for dry ingredients that you scoop and flatten.
- K: Pack firmly, level off → used for things like brown sugar or peanut butter that need to be pressed down.
- L: Pour, view at eye level → only for liquids.
Now let’s go line by line:
---
1. ¾ cup milk
→ Milk is a liquid → use liquid measuring cup (I)
→ Method: pour and check at eye level → L
✔ Correct: I, L
---
2. 1 cup brown sugar
→ Brown sugar is dry but needs to be packed → use 1-cup dry measure (E)
→ Method: pack firmly, then level → K
✔ Correct: E, K
---
3. ½ cup flour
→ Flour is dry → use ½ cup dry measure (F)
→ Method: dip in and level off → J
✔ Correct: F, J
---
4. 1 teaspoon vanilla
→ Vanilla is a liquid, but it’s a very small amount → use measuring spoon (C = 1 tsp)

5. ¼ cup oil
→ Oil is liquid → but ¼ cup is a larger amount → should we use liquid cup (I) or dry cup (H)?
Important rule: For liquids, always use the liquid measuring cup, even if it’s ¼ cup. Dry cups are for dry ingredients. So even though H is ¼ cup, it’s for dry stuff. For oil, use I (liquid cup).

6. 1 cup granulated sugar
→ Granulated sugar is dry → use 1-cup dry measure (E)
→ Method: dip in and level off → J (not packed — unlike brown sugar)
Student wrote E, J — ✔ correct.
---
7. ⅔ cups oatmeal
→ Oatmeal is dry → need to combine measures. ⅔ = ⅓ + → so use two ⅓ cup measures (G + G)
→ Method: dip in and level off → J
Student wrote G+G, J — ✔ correct.
---
8. ¼ cup peanut butter
→ Peanut butter is thick and sticky → needs to be packed → use ¼ cup dry measure (H)
→ Method: pack firmly, level off → K
Student wrote H, K — ✔ correct.
---
9. 1 tablespoon baking soda
→ Baking soda is dry powder → use 1 Tbsp measuring spoon (D)
→ Method: dip in and level off → J
Student wrote D, J — ✔ correct.
---
10. ⅓ cup shortening
→ Shortening is solid/fatty → often packed → use ⅓ cup dry measure (G)
→ Method: pack firmly, level off → K
Student wrote G, K — ✔ correct.
---
11. ¼ teaspoon cinnamon
→ Very small dry amount → use ¼ tsp measuring spoon (A)
→ Method: dip in and level off → J
Student wrote A, J — ✔ correct.
